In 2024, MEDIAMETRIE achieves revenue of 95.8 M€. Revenue is growing positively over 9 years (CAGR: +1.0%). Vs 2023: +1%. After deducting consumption (894 k€), gross margin stands at 94.9 M€, i.e. a rate of 99%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ches 11.5 M€, representing 12.0% of revenue. This level of operating margin is satisfactory for the sector.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 1.8 M€, i.e. 1.9%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Solvency and debt ratios
The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 4%. This very low level reflects a solid financial structure, offering significant room for future investments or acquisitions.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 60%. This high autonomy means the company finances most of its assets through equity, a sign of strength. Debt repayment capacity (= Financial debt / Cash flow) indicates it would take 0.3 years of cash flow to repay all financial debt. This short period demonstrates excellent debt sustainability. Cash flow represents 8.0% of revenue. Cash flow measures resources generated by operations, available for investment and debt repayment. Satisfactory level allowing partial financing of growth.

Liquidity ratios
The liquidity ratio (= Current assets / Current liabilities) stands at 175.59. Concretely, the company has €2 of liquid assets for every €1 of short-term debt: no cash risk within 12 months. The interest coverage ratio (= EBIT / Interest expenses) is 5.5x. Operating income very largely covers interest expenses: high safety margin.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 58 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 74 days. Favorable situation: supplier credit is longer than customer credit by 16 days. Inventory turnover is 2 days (= Average inventory / Cost of goods x 360). Fast turnover, sign of good inventory management. Overall, WCR represents 1 days of revenue, i.e. 151 k€ to permanently finance. Notable WCR improvement over the period (-95%), freeing up cash.
